Meaning of Phinnaeus

Phinnaeus is a captivating and distinctive name for baby boys. With its origins rooted in the Hebrew language, Phinnaeus carries a rich history and meaningful associations. This unique name is often pronounced as fi-NEE-uhs (/fɪˈniːəs/) in English-speaking countries. Although it may have variations such as Phineas, the pronunciation remains the same across different regions, including both American and British English. While not exceedingly common, Phinnaeus has been steadily gaining popularity over the years in the United States, making it an intriguing choice for parents seeking a name that stands out from the crowd.
